Texas Senate Bill 1819 Case Study
The Texas Senate Bill 1819 would repeal a 2001 HB 1403 that allows illegal immigrants to pay in–
state tuition at public colleges and universities. The Bill was proposed by Texas State Sen. Donna
Campbell, who feels, "We need to direct our resources first and foremost to the legal residents of
Texas." The current law allows illegal alien students who have lived in Texas for at least three years
that pledge to apply for legal status, to pay in–state tuition rates. Bill 1819 would terminate this law
and let universities establish a policy to, "verify to the satisfaction of the institution" that a student is
a legal resident or citizen. It would affect all illegal immigrant students applying to Texas Colleges
and Universities.
In the past there have been attempts to repeal the tuition law, but they have generally failed without
support or attention. Republicans have said the current policy makes economical sense, and other
supporters of the current policy highlight that Texas' universities have gotten financial gains from
what illegal immigrant students pay in tuition and fees. Which was around $42.4 million in 2012,
and around $51.6 million in 2013 (according to the Texas Higher Education Coordinating Board).

Texas Sunset Advisory Commission Case Study
The Texas Sunset Advisory Commission is a government agency whose goal is "to establish an
ongoing and regular evaluation of government effectiveness and efficiency" ("Improving State
Agency..."). The way it works, according to the Texas State Library Archives, is that the Sunset
Commission periodically reviews government agencies to ensure that they are operating the way
they were established to operate. Every year a group of agencies is set for review. The Sunset
Advisory Commission has to review the agencies and must determine whether the agency will be
allowed to continue operation as is, make some changes to meet the effectiveness level determined
by the Sunset Commission or if it is deemed unnecessary by the Sunset Commission, the agency

Both the agency's self–evaluation report to the commission and the commission's final report to the
legislature must address each of these criteria. The criteria include the agency's efficiency of
operation, the extent to which statutory objectives have been achieved, the extent to which existing
advisory committees are needed and used, the extent of duplication or overlapping jurisdictions and
possibilities for consolidation with other agencies, and an assessment of whether the agency has
recommended statutory changes that benefit the general public rather than the regulated entity. Other
criteria include the promptness and effectiveness with which the agency handles complaints, the
extent to which the agency has encouraged participation by the public, the extent of compliance with
federal and state requirements regarding equality of employment opportunity and the rights and
privacy of individuals, compliance with the Public Information Act and Open Meetings Act, and the
degree to which the agency conforms to its six–year strategic

Texas Senate Research Paper
The Texas state legislature is responsible for addressing constituents' interests and concerns. It is
composed of two chambers or houses: The House of Representatives (150 members) and The Senate
(31 members). House members serve for two years, each representing a district and 168,000 people.
In the other hand, Senators serve four–year terms and represent approximately 811,000 constituents.
The Texas Constitution of 1876 mandated that requirements should be minimal, open to most
citizens with little or no training in politics. In order to become a member of the Texas senate, a
senator must be qualified to vote, a resident of Texas for five years and of the district for one year.
House members must be U.S. citizens, qualified voters,

Argumentative Essay On Texas
The Texas Senate Bill, commonly referred to as the Texas SB 5, can be described as a policy which
was created on 11th June 2013in Texas articulating a list of intricate measures that add up and
regulate abortion rules and regulations. The measures which were proclaimed by the enactment of
this policy included a thorough ban on abortion given that abortion is at its 20 weeks post–
fertilization and these measures was used to depict that the Texas state has a stringent compelling
role and interest into the protection of all fetuses from excruciating pain. The Bill was successfully
enacted into law after being pushed by Governor Rick Perry (Nicole 12).
The bill, additionally, mandated that any doctor in Texas who performs any form of activity which
leads to abortion must have admitted privileges and prerogatives at any nearly health institution or
hospital and must also meet all the required standards as any surgical health–care institution in
